How do i get a message to pop up when you put your mouse over an object in Flash?
Scott
-
Make the txt where you like it and click the keyframe , press F8 and choose movieclip , name it txt . Edit the new moviecllip and add a new keyframe (#2) , remove the txt from the keyframe 1 and add a *Stop* action in both frames .Go back to main and add this action to a button : On mouse over tell target /txt and play , click the *end on* line and add this : on mouse roll out tell target /txt and stop .
